About Revlon Group Holdings’s Workforce
Revlon Group Holdings LLC is a Wellness Products company that employs 13,970 people worldwide as of March 2026. It is the 9th-largest by headcount among its peers. Founded in 1932, the company is headquartered in New York City, New York.
Revlon Group Holdings's workforce has declined 1.4% from 2023 to 2026, down 0.3% year over year in 2026. Its workforce is concentrated most in North America (42.7%), followed by Southern Europe (11.1%) and South Asia (10.0%).
Revlon Group Holdings's functional groups are Finance and Operations (38.7%), Engineering (38.3%), and Sales and Marketing (23.0%). The average salary is $60,867, ranging from a median of $73,000 in North America to $7,000 in South Asia.
Revlon Group Holdings's active job postings fell 56.4% in 2026 to 98, with new postings per month cooling from 155 in 2023 to 49 in 2026. Overall employee sentiment is neutral but declining.
